Liquidity Stress Oscillator Pro2

Liquidity Stress Oscillator Pro2
The Liquidity Stress Oscillator Pro2 is a macro risk-regime indicator designed to visualize broad market liquidity stress using a weighted composite of credit, volatility, dollar strength, funding pressure, and yield-curve conditions.
This oscillator is intended to help traders identify when macro liquidity conditions are improving, neutral, deteriorating, or entering elevated stress. In the BTC comparison shown, the oscillator highlights several major macro regime transitions that have aligned with important Bitcoin cycle shifts.
What It Measures;
LSO Pro2 combines normalized z-scores from multiple macro stress inputs:
- CCC option-adjusted spreads
- High-yield credit spreads
- MOVE bond volatility index
- U.S. Dollar Index
- SOFR / repo stress proxy
- 10Y-2Y yield curve
Each component is converted into a z-score over the selected lookback period, then blended into a weighted composite. The yield curve component is inverted so that deeper curve weakness contributes to higher stress.
Regime Levels;
The oscillator uses adjustable regime thresholds to help dial in trends on different timeframes.
Extreme Risk Off
Risk Off
Neutral
Risk On
The line color, background shading, and regime markers update automatically as the composite moves between regimes.

How To Use;
Rising LSO values indicate increasing macro stress and tightening liquidity conditions. Falling LSO values indicate easing stress and improving risk appetite.
Risk On regimes may support stronger risk-asset environments, while Risk Off and Extreme Risk Off regimes may warn of elevated caution, deleveraging, or liquidity pressure.
This tool is best used as a macro regime filter alongside price action, trend structure, volume, and risk management. It is not designed to generate standalone buy or sell signals.
Notes;
Some symbols may depend on TradingView data availability. If a component does not load on your chart, replace it in the indicator settings with an equivalent symbol supported by your data feed.
Default weights emphasize credit stress, especially CCC spreads, because lower-quality credit markets often react strongly during liquidity contractions.
